Jeux de caractères - UTF-8 - ISO-8859-1

Installation & Configuration du logiciel
Répondre
Toolin
Gsup LEVEL 1
Messages : 20
Enregistré le : lun. 4 févr. 2013 12:24

Bonjour,
J'ai fait une migration de GestSup d'un hébergement OVH dont le jeu de caractère utilisé était ISO-8859-1 vers un VPS en UTF-8 et j'ai eu pas mal de problème de caractères.(accentuation qui ne passe pas)

Voici des points à vérifier:

- réenregistrement de certains fichiers PHP de gestsup en utf-8 via gedit ou notepad++
- modification des fichiers php en précisant <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
- export depuis phpmyadmin OVH ( j'ai pas pu choisir le jeu de caractère) et import via phpmyadmin de mon VPS en précisant bien que la source est ISO-8859-1

j'ai aussi configuré apache, ainsi que le serveur MySQL
et après quelques prises de tête cela fonctionne !

Des liens intéressants qui m'ont bien aidé :

- http://www.siteduzero.com/informatique/ ... caracteres
- http://openweb.eu.org/articles/changer_pour_utf8
- http://cameronyule.com/2008/07/configur ... use-utf-8/

a bientôt :-)
www.toolin.fr
Webmarketing, Systèmes Informatiques et Réseaux
Toolin
Gsup LEVEL 1
Messages : 20
Enregistré le : lun. 4 févr. 2013 12:24

ouai, en fait, mon truc ca marchait pas terrible du tout en fait.

et pour cause, dans l'export SQL je me récupérai des CHARSET=latin1 que j'ai transormé en CHARSET=utf8

comme pour la table tcategory

Code : Tout sélectionner

CREATE TABLE IF NOT EXISTS `tcategory` (
  `id` int(11) NOT NULL AUTO_INCREMENT,
  `name` varchar(50) NOT NULL,
  PRIMARY KEY (`id`)
) ENGINE=InnoDB  DEFAULT CHARSET=latin1 AUTO_INCREMENT=3 ;
du coup, faut faire ca pour chaque table avant l'import ;)
www.toolin.fr
Webmarketing, Systèmes Informatiques et Réseaux
Avatar du membre
Flox
Administrateur du site
Messages : 9431
Enregistré le : jeu. 21 juin 2012 19:00

Bonjour,

avec PhpMyadmin vous pouvez préciser l'encodage lors de l'export:

Code : Tout sélectionner

Jeu de caractères du fichier :
cdt
GestSup: 3.2.47 | Debian: 12 | Apache: 2.4.59 | MariaDB: 11.5.2 | PHP: 8.3.12 | https://doc.gestsup.fr/
Toolin
Gsup LEVEL 1
Messages : 20
Enregistré le : lun. 4 févr. 2013 12:24

je pense que vous parler du jeu de caractère du fichier texte généré lors de l'export.
Et ce jeu de caractère n'a rien à voir avec le jeu de caractère des tables Mysql qui sont précisé "à l'intérieur" du fichier d'export ;)

y a 2 trucs en fait
www.toolin.fr
Webmarketing, Systèmes Informatiques et Réseaux
Répondre